Digital technology: precision and customization through 3D innovation
Modern oral prosthetics are no longer crafted by eye and hand alone. Digital scanning enables the creation of highly accurate, 3D representations of the mouth. This data is used with CAD/CAM software to design restorations that fit as precisely as natural teeth.
Once the design is finalized, milling devices or 3D printers produce the physical appliance from high-density resin blocks. The result is a custom-fit restoration with far fewer adjustments needed. The digital workflow also allows for quicker delivery and easier replication, should a replacement ever be necessary.
Implant-supported solutions: stability meets confidence
One of the most transformative innovations in restorative dentistry is the use of implants to anchor oral prosthetics. Titanium posts are surgically embedded into the jawbone, creating a stable foundation that holds the prosthetic in place—much like natural roots.
This approach significantly improves chewing ability and eliminates slippage. There are both removable options that snap onto implants and fixed solutions that remain securely in place. Patients often report greater ease during meals and more confidence in conversation, knowing their appliance won’t shift unexpectedly.

Instant vs. conventional options: which approach suits you best?
When it comes to replacing lost teeth, timing is everything. Immediate prosthetics —sometimes known as same-day appliances—are made in advance and placed right after extractions. This allows patients to leave the clinic with a full smile, even before healing has completed.
However, as the gums and bone settle, these early models may need adjustments or relining. In contrast, traditional restorations are fabricated only after healing, which typically results in a more stable and customized fit.
Choosing between these options depends on your healing profile, lifestyle needs, and how much adaptation you’re comfortable with during the recovery phase.
Enhancing comfort with soft liners and cushioning technology
Many patients find that even a well-designed appliance can cause occasional pressure or friction. That’s where soft liners come in. These pliable materials are placed between the appliance and the gum, acting as a shock absorber to reduce discomfort.
Particularly useful for those with sensitive oral tissues or irregular jaw anatomy, these liners can dramatically improve wearability. Innovations in pressure-distribution design also help evenly spread bite forces, minimizing sore spots and improving overall comfort—especially over long hours of use.
Aesthetic breakthroughs: restorations that look and feel real
In the past, artificial teeth often appeared unnaturally uniform or overly white. Today, the artistry of restoration has caught up with the science.
Technicians now use layered shading techniques to replicate the natural gradient found in real teeth. Each tooth can be shaped, tinted, and positioned to match the patient’s facial structure, age, and even speech patterns.
Furthermore, the gum base of modern appliances often includes details like natural textures, subtle color variations, and even translucent areas, all designed to enhance realism. The result? A smile that looks as authentic as it feels.
Long-term care: protecting your investment and oral health
Proper care extends the life of your appliance and supports oral well-being.
- Clean your restoration daily with a brush specifically designed for removable prosthetics.
- Avoid regular toothpaste—it may be too abrasive. Use mild cleansers or soaking tablets designed for this purpose.
- Keep the appliance moist when not in use. Drying can lead to material distortion.
